Askey and Canoga Perkins Partner at MWC Barcelona to Deliver Rapid-Deploy 5G Critical Communications Solutions

Date: 2026-04-29

BARCELONA, SPAIN -- Askey and Canoga Perkins announced at Mobile World Congress Barcelona a Global Partnership to Deliver SyncMetra® Network Connectivity Solution, combining Canoga Perkins’ software-defined, IT-operated private 5G network transport along with Askey’s carrier-grade 5G radio access technology.

At MWC Barcelona 2026, Askey Computer Corporation and Canoga Perkins announced a strategic partnership to deploy Canoga Perkins' SyncMetra® Platform across enterprise and service provider markets with Askey. This partnership pairs Askey’s carrier-grade radio access capabilities with Canoga Perkins’ industry-leading time-sensitive networking (TSN) and synchronization technology, enabling customers to simplify deployment of ultra-low-latency, highly reliable network services for 5G, edge compute, industrial automation, and mission-critical enterprise applications.

The partnership enables joint go-to-market efforts, integrated product offerings, and expanded access to SyncMetra through Askey’s sales channels in Asia, Europe, and the Americas. SyncMetra provides precision timing, synchronization, and network conditioning features that support deterministic packet delivery and sub-microsecond timing accuracy across complex network domains. By embedding these capabilities into Askey-delivered systems and certified designs, the organizations expect to accelerate adoption of TSN-enabled services and lower total cost of ownership for operators deploying next-generation connected systems.

Canoga Perkins’ SyncMetra along with Askey’s portfolio of 5G radios and industrial routers will deliver precision synchronization, packet conditioning, and network assurance features. The joint solution supports standards-based timing protocols, including IEEE 1588 Precision Time Protocol (PTP), SyncE, and Synchronous Ethernet, while also providing advanced telemetry for service assurance and network visibility. Early trials with select service providers and enterprise customers have demonstrated improved latency determinism and simplified commissioning workflows compared with traditional synchronization approaches.
